One of the key aspects of new cyber essentials is the emphasis on employee training and awareness. Human error is one of the leading causes of cyber breaches, and organizations need to educate their employees on how to recognize and respond to potential threats. This includes providing regular cybersecurity training, educating employees on best practices for handling sensitive information, and promoting a culture of security awareness within the organization.

Additionally, new cyber essentials also stress the importance of implementing multi-factor authentication (MFA) to enhance security. MFA adds an extra layer of protection by requiring users to provide two or more forms of verification to access a system or application. This helps prevent unauthorized access even if a password is compromised, making it significantly harder for cyber criminals to breach systems.

Another essential component of new cyber essentials is the implementation of regular software updates and patches. Software vulnerabilities are a common entry point for cyber attackers, and keeping systems up to date with the latest security patches is crucial for mitigating these risks. Failure to update software leaves systems vulnerable to exploitation by cyber criminals, making regular patching an essential part of any organization’s cybersecurity strategy.

Moreover, the use of encryption is another critical aspect of new cyber essentials. Encryption is a method of encoding data to make it unreadable to unauthorized users, ensuring that sensitive information remains secure. By encrypting data both in transit and at rest, organizations can protect their data from interception and unauthorized access, reducing the risk of data breaches.

Furthermore, new cyber essentials also stress the importance of implementing a robust incident response plan. Despite best efforts to prevent cyber attacks, no organization is immune to breaches. Having a well-defined incident response plan in place can help organizations quickly detect, contain, and recover from cyber security incidents, minimizing the impact on the business and its stakeholders.

In addition to these key components, new cyber essentials also recommend the use of network segmentation to reduce the impact of a potential breach. By dividing networks into smaller, isolated segments, organizations can limit the spread of malware and unauthorized access within their systems, providing an added layer of protection against cyber threats.
